Henke was born April 10, 1966, in Columbus, Nebraska.  

He has dozens of film and TV credits, according to IMBd

Including recurring roles in "The Stand," "Manhunt, "Sneaky Pete," "Justified," "Lost," "October Road" and "Dexter. 

His latest role was in 2022 movie "Block Party." 

Acting wasn't Henke's first career. He played football at the University of Arizona and was drafted by the New York Giants in 1989, but was cut from the team during training camp 

He retired from football in 1994 after struggling with multiple injuries. 

Henke was married to Katelin Chesna from 2001 to 2008. 

In May 2021, he posted a video from a hospital bed saying he was "happy to be alive" after surviving a 90% blockage in his artery.  

In September 2021, he shared that he was "recovered and feeling better than I have in 15 years." 

Henke's publicist Caitlin Green confirmed his death to USA TODAY. No additional information was provided.
